WINEMAKING
Slow alcoholic fermentation of whole grapes in small stainless steel tanks with indigenous yeast. Prolonged maceration, while avoiding over-extraction. Malolactic fermentation in French oak barrels. All transfers are gravity-fed and carried out with the utmost care. Preserving the primary, fruity aromas and striving to maintain the great depth of color characteristic of the region.
TASTING NOTES
A wine with a deep, intense color; glyceric and unctuous in the glass. An intense nose, with sensations of fresh fruit wrapped in very well-integrated oak that complements, but does not mask, the full varietal character of Tinta del País from Ribera del Duero. Fresh and lively on the palate, with elegant complexity, creamy nuances, and subtle toasted notes. Enveloping, dense, and well-integrated tannins. Subtle and elegant. Well-balanced for drinking now, with the potential to age in the bottle for several years.
